A tin can whirled on the end of a string moves in a circle because
Ilya [14]

Answer:

There is an inward force acting on the can

Explanation:

This inward force is known as Centripetal force and it is responsible for making the can whirl on the end of a string in circle and it is also directed towards the center around which the can is moving.
